Key Areas of Maintenance

To assist property owners remain on top of conservatory maintenance, it is beneficial to break down the tasks into workable classifications. Below are some essential areas of maintenance along with the suggested frequency for each task.

1. Cleaning the Glass

  • Frequency: Twice a year (Spring and Autumn)
  • Method:
    • Use a soft cloth or sponge with a mild detergent.
    • Avoid utilizing abrasive cleaners that can scratch the glass.
    • Take notice of the frames and any seals to avoid water ingress.

2. Checking and Cleaning Gutters

  • Frequency: Twice a year (before winter season and after autumn leaves fall)
  • Method:
    • Clear away debris such as leaves, branches, and dirt.
    • Guarantee the downspouts are not obstructed.
    • Use a ladder carefully or employ a professional if necessary.

3. Inspecting the Framework

  • Frequency: Monthly
  • Approach:
    • Inspect for rust, specifically if made from metal.
    • Check for any indications of rot or decay, especially in wooden frames.
    • Sand down and repaint where necessary to avoid more damage.

4. Maintaining Doors and Windows

  • Frequency: Monthly
  • Approach:
    • Ensure hinges and locks are working efficiently.
    • Apply lubricant to hinges as needed.
    • Examine the seals around windows and doors for air leaks and change if needed.

5. Taking care of Flooring

  • Frequency: As required
  • Technique:
    • Depending on the flooring type (tiles, carpet, etc), clean accordingly.
    • Use suitable cleansing options to prevent damage.
    • Look for indications of moisture which might suggest leaks or condensation issues.

6. Cooling And Heating Systems Maintenance

  • Frequency: Annually
  • Technique:
    • Inspect heating systems or cooling units.
    • Tidy vents and filters to guarantee effectiveness.
    • Call a professional technician for a comprehensive inspection.

7. Bug Prevention

  • Frequency: Ongoing
  • Method:
    • Regularly check for signs of insects such as pests or rodents.
    • Take preventive measures like sealing little spaces and guaranteeing correct drain.
    • Consider professional bug control if infestations are discovered.

Seasonal Maintenance Tasks

Different seasons bring unique challenges and requirements for conservatory maintenance. Below is a breakdown of critical seasonal jobs:

Spring

  • Check for Damage: After winter season, check for any structural damage caused by snow or ice.
  • Deep Clean: Clean both the glass and surrounding areas completely.
  • Check Heating: Ensure that heater are operational before the cooler months get here.

Summer season

  • Shading: Consider installing shading services like blinds or outdoor awnings to decrease heat accumulation.
  • Window Screens: Install screens if insects are an issue throughout warmer months.

Autumn

  • Rain gutter Cleaning: Remove leaves and debris to avoid obstructions.
  • Avoid Heat Loss: Check seals and consider changing window treatments to improve insulation.

Winter

  • Snow Removal: Carefully remove snow from the roof and prevent using too much pressure that may damage the structure.
  • Display for Ice: Check for any ice buildup that might impact drainage or damage the roof.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How typically should I clean my conservatory?

It is recommended to clean your conservatory a minimum of twice a year to maintain look and functionality. More frequent cleaning might be required depending upon ecological aspects.

2. What are the signs that my conservatory requires repairs?

Signs can include leaks, drafts, visible damage to the structure, or condensation and mold growth. Regular evaluations can assist capture these issues early.

3. Is professional maintenance necessary?

While numerous maintenance jobs can be performed by property owners, professional help might be useful for intricate issues or hard-to-reach areas, specifically when handling heat and cooling systems.

4. How can I improve the energy efficiency of my conservatory?

Consider installing energy-efficient glass, including window treatments, weather removing, and proper insulation to improve energy efficiency and reduce heating and cooling expenses.
